Let's Do Something! was the successful 2007 Birmingham mayoral election campaign slogan for candidate Larry Langford. It was a direct criticism of the incumbent Bernard Kincaid, who was known for being very meticulous, which gave the perception that progress was not being made. Langford, on the other hand, had a track record of making quick decisions when he was Mayor of Fairfield and president of the Jefferson County Commission. Langford won the election outright without the need for a runoff. As Mayor of Birmingham, Langford kept his promise and quickly made sweeping changes and proposals.
